MECUM - Very nice '70 Chevelle SS convertible (L34) went for $144,900 with commissions. Looks like this was the highest price for all Chevelles offered on this particular day.

I saw that Fathom Blue Chevelle Convt.in St.Louis years ago.It was at a "VOLO" type carbrokers showroom.I took pix then and it was nice.Up in the air with wheels off etc.
They wanted 100K 5 years ago.
As soon as I saw it on the Mecum menu,I knew which one it was.
$128K it sold +11% more in fees for the $144K final.
Also:
#C49 White/Red LS-6 sold 66,150.00.
#S11 Red/Red LS-6 Convt. sold $73,150.00.
